98 explorer front brake problem
I've got a 98 explorer and it keeps burning up front brakes rapidly, I've bled the system several times, removed all the fluid and replaced. The brakes are wearing the outside pad first and at an angle (both wheels). When I install new pads they seem free for a few miles then they begin to drag and squeak. I'm considering putting in a couple of caliper kits, but the quad has very little miles on, never been winter driven and they don't appear to be corroded. Any suggestions?
